Recognize the Situation Fast

Time is everything. ER teams must quickly assess whether the patient is in a shockable or non-shockable rhythm, identify the cause, and begin immediate treatment. Accurate ECG interpretation and knowledge of ACLS protocols help guide the next steps, but speed is just as important as accuracy.

Step Into the Leadership Role

A clear team leader is essential during a code. Leadership involves more than giving commands—it’s assigning roles, maintaining focus, and ensuring closed-loop communication so that every instruction is heard, understood, and confirmed. This minimizes mistakes and keeps the team aligned.

Consider Reversible Causes Early

While CPR and defibrillation are key components, don’t overlook reversible causes. The H’s and T’s—such as hypoxia, hypovolemia, and tension pneumothorax—should be evaluated early in the code. Identifying and treating the underlying issue could be what ultimately restores circulation.

Use Tools, But Trust Your Training

Technology such as defibrillators, capnography, and CPR feedback devices are powerful tools, but your clinical judgment matters most. Familiarity with medication dosages, rhythm recognition, and airway management gives you the confidence to act decisively under pressure.

Train Like It’s the Real Thing

Mock codes, simulation training, and staying up to date with the latest ACLS guidelines sharpen your skills. When a real code happens, that training will kick in—turning a high-stress situation into a coordinated, life-saving effort.
